A burst pipe call has a specific sequence — find the source, stop it, open only what's necessary, and coordinate repair — here's how our Braintree, MA crews run it.

We locate and confirm the shutoff valve is closed the moment the crew arrives.
We locate the failure point before opening any drywall, avoiding guesswork demolition.
Wall cavity extraction addresses moisture a surface-level approach would miss.
Saturated insulation is removed and replaced, while drywall is cut only at the confirmed wet line.
Specialized drying equipment reaches into open wall cavities to dry framing and remaining materials.
Our Braintree, MA team can refer or work alongside a plumber so mitigation and repair stay on the same timeline.
